GE in Schenectady, New York has already been in the news for welcoming President Obama last summer, as featured on '60 Minutes.'  Now, Schenectady's General Electric plant will be featured in a 45 second commerical during the Super Bowl.

The national ad features Schenectady employees building steam turbines, which are used by Anheuser-Busch to brew beer.  The spot was filmed in the Electric City and at Wolf's 1-11 bar on Wolf Rd. in Colonie.

GE Thermal Products President and CEO Paul Browning told YNN, "We want people to know that our employees are powering the world. A very practical example of this, and a great fit for a Super Bowl commercial, is brewing and refrigerating beer. GE turbine technology is a vital part of powering the production of recognizable products and services around the globe, and thousands of employees in Schenectady make it possible.”
